Overview of Cleansing Approaches



When choosing a cleansing approach, comprehending the differences in between pressure cleaning and traditional cleansing methods is necessary.

Pressure cleaning uses high-pressure water jets to get rid of dirt, grime, and discolorations from surfaces like driveways, decks, and exterior siding. This method is effective, particularly for hard, stubborn discolorations that might stand up to standard cleansing.

On the other hand, typical cleansing typically involves scrubbing surfaces with brushes, sponges, or towels, often incorporated with detergents or soaps. It's a more hands-on method, relying on exertion and time to attain cleanliness.

Standard techniques can be effective, but they may not address deeply embedded dirt or huge areas as rapidly as stress cleaning can.

Additionally, you need to think about the surface areas you're cleaning up. While stress washing is excellent for resilient surfaces, it might harm softer materials or delicate locations otherwise done very carefully.

Traditional cleansing approaches have a tendency to be safer for various surfaces but could require even more initiative and time.

Eventually, your choice relies on the cleansing task available, the sort of surface area, and your desired end result. By recognizing these techniques, you can make an educated decision that meets your cleansing requires.
